What are ‘free ports’ and would they boost post-Brexit trade?

Boris Johnson and Jeremy Hunt accused of trying to turn UK into tax haven

Boris Johnson and Jeremy Hunt have been accused of trying to turn the UK into a haven for tax evaders and money launderers, after both Tory leadership rivals backed the creation of so-called “free ports” on the east coast of the UK.
